hi,
Damit der Link nicht ausgeführt wird, muss onclick »false« zurückgeben. Das kann über Deine Funktion zentral geschehen (vermeidet Code-Redundanz)
Wo gehört denn das „return false“ in einer Funktion hingeschrieben?
<script type="text/javascript">
function Bildtauschen(id, url)
{
document.getElementById(id).src = url;
return false; // funzt[™] nicht
}
</script>
Wenn ich das „return false“ direkt in den Link einbaue funktionierts.
<a href="/IMG_0781.jpg" onclick="Bildtauschen('objekt_Galerie', this.href); return false">
<img src="/0781.jpg" alt="" />
</a>
mfg
--
echo '<pre>'; var_dump($Malcolm_Beck`s); echo '</pre>';
array(2) {
["SELFCODE"]=>
string(74) "ie:( fl:) br:> va:? ls:? fo:) rl:| n4:# ss:{ de:? js:} ch:? sh:( mo:? zu:("
["Meaningful"]=>
string(?) "Der Sinn des Lebens ist deinem Leben einen Sinn zu geben"
}
echo '<pre>'; var_dump($Malcolm_Beck`s); echo '</pre>';
array(2) {
["SELFCODE"]=>
string(74) "ie:( fl:) br:> va:? ls:? fo:) rl:| n4:# ss:{ de:? js:} ch:? sh:( mo:? zu:("
["Meaningful"]=>
string(?) "Der Sinn des Lebens ist deinem Leben einen Sinn zu geben"
}